Output 5fbbccae1e67d43a70d62354ca502ebf708cc65ee01b53dfa918f5acbb668d60:0

value
602693
script pubkey
OP_0 OP_PUSHBYTES_20 2654dce4150fb693ca5b37a00016cc91b27a1f26
address
bc1qye2deeq4p7mf8jjmx7sqq9kvjxe858exy4xmp2
transaction
5fbbccae1e67d43a70d62354ca502ebf708cc65ee01b53dfa918f5acbb668d60
confirmations
190550
spent
true